What is Sharewell?
Sharewell is a cloud-based collaboration platform that combines a suite of productivity and communication tools to support efficient teamwork in both professional and personal environments. Its primary focus is to simplify workflows, enable smoother communication, and create a digital space where team members can interact, collaborate, and share resources effortlessly.
With an intuitive design and advanced capabilities, Sharewell provides a versatile solution for organizations of all sizes to improve collaboration, project management, and task execution.

Compared to Other Tools:
Sharewell vs. Slack:
-
Slack is a widely used communication platform known for its messaging features, integrations, and channels. However, Sharewell offers a more comprehensive set of tools beyond messaging, including project management, video conferencing, and customizable workspaces, which may appeal to businesses seeking a more all-encompassing collaboration platform.
Sharewell vs. Microsoft Teams:
-
Microsoft Teams is known for its integration with Office 365 and enterprise-grade features. Sharewell, on the other hand, provides a simpler and more user-friendly interface with additional customization options for smaller teams. Teams may find Sharewell more accessible and easier to use for basic collaboration tasks.
Sharewell vs. Trello:
-
Trello is a powerful task management tool that allows teams to organize and manage tasks using a board system. While Sharewell does provide task management features, Trello is more specialized in project tracking and task organization. Sharewell, however, excels in providing integrated communication features, including real-time messaging and video conferencing.
